    This Property, and especially the owner Janet, exceeded my expectations. In the past we have trailered to the Baja and camped near TS. I wanted to try a house rental and this Property met my needs as to size, location & cost. Peggy is an artist & I make jewelry. We both set up operations on the ample patios and worked parts of most days. I was very pleased that the main house was occupied by the owners, as this assured a great deal of security for our belongings. The WiFi internet access was also very important for me, and worked very well. We have a Westie dog who travels everywhere with us so the "Pet Friendly" aspect was crucial. We drive to TS from Pender Island in BC and so we have a vehicle in TS, which is necessary for this and any other property rental here. Walking is not a great option. The TS unpaved roads leave a lot to be desired. Why can't the town hire a grader operator for a few days a month to smooth things out. The roads in town are a like a minefield, but nobody speeds. I would definitely recommend this property and will rent it again in the future. Barking dogs & crowing roosters are a challenge, but Janet supplies earplugs and one quickly gets used to the noises. Hint: close the windows & put fans on low for the night, almost cancels out the noises. We go to the beach every afternoon. Cerritos is the safest, with lifeguards and lots of people near the Beach Bar. All dogs on the beach are friendly and our little guy loved it here. A 5 minute walk down the beach gets you 5 miles of your own "private"beach. Las Palmas is another favorite. Security hint: go on weekends when there will be more people here, it is a little isolated. Buy fish from the fishermen at The Fishermen's Beach" when they come in in the afternoon. They will clean & fillet the fish if you ask. Be careful on most beaches as they are steep with dangerous undertows. Go to the Saturday morning "Gringo" market at La Canada. Enjoy John B
